Simple Cutting and Trimming: You can easily remove commercials from TV recordings or trim the beginning and end of home videos without re-encoding, which saves significant time on slower processors.Format Conversion: Convert old mobile phone videos or bulky AVI files into more efficient formats like MP4 (H.264).Video Filters: Apply basic corrections like resizing, cropping, color adjustment, and deinterlacing to improve the quality of older footage.No Installation Needed: If you prefer not to install software, you can often find "Portable" versions of Avidemux for Windows XP that run directly from a USB drive. Windows XP users often struggle to find modern software that is still compatible with their system. Avidemux is a perfect match for this OS because it uses minimal system resources and provides essential features without unnecessary bloat. It supports a wide variety of file types, including AVI, MP4, MKV, and MPEG, making it a versatile tool for handling digital video collections on older hardware.
